benefits of sinus lifts
Add bone height in the upper jaw for implants.
enables implants
This procedure creates the necessary bone height in the upper jaw to successfully place dental implants.
bone added
The sinus floor is gently lifted and filled with bone grafting material to increase support for implants.
gentle procedure
The sinus lift is performed with precision and care to ensure your comfort throughout treatment.
improved support
It builds a stable and secure foundation that allows dental restorations to last long-term.
detailed planning
Advanced 3D imaging is used to map your anatomy and guide treatment for the best results.
long-term benefit
By increasing bone volume, the procedure sets you up for successful implant placement in the future.
common questions
Here are answers to common sinus lift questions.
is this surgery painful?
You’ll be comfortably numb during the procedure thanks to local anesthesia, and most patients experience only mild soreness afterward—often described as similar to recovering from a routine dental extraction.
will it change my sinus pressure?
You may notice a slight feeling of pressure or fullness in the sinus area for a few days, but this is temporary and normal sinus function usually returns as your body heals.
can I fly soon after?
It’s best to wait about 7–10 days before flying after getting a sinus lift to avoid changes in cabin pressure that can affect internal healing or cause sinus discomfort.
how do I know if I need it?
We use diagnostic imaging like x-rays or 3D scans to evaluate your bone height and determine if a sinus lift is necessary to safely support a dental implant in the upper jaw.
